About Belgaum City

Belgaum, located in the state of Karnataka is a swathe of soul-quenching, emerald green landscape, oozing old-world charm. The city has a fairly great share of breath-taking waterfalls and misty hills, where you can reach for the clouds. There are plenty of religious monuments as well, to enkindle your spiritual spark. Though Belgaum is part of the state Karnataka in India, it is close to several other states like Maharashtra and Goa, creating an exquisite blend of three cultures and a rich heritage. It goes without saying, that Belgaum would be the city to head to if you want to experience the culinary delights of the three states in India, each unique and delectable in their own inherent way.

About Lucknow City

City of Nawabs, capital city of Uttar Pradesh, Lucknow is famous for its monuments, food, clothing in all of which, one can see the traces and grandeur of Mughal reign. Situated on the banks of the Gomti River, Lucknow is famous for its culture, food, heritage and its traditional dance form Kathak. Remnants of its rich historical and cultural past are well displayed here through the architectural designs, the handicrafts and the typical Lucknowi way of life. Lucknow was a symbol of Hindi-Muslim-Sikh harmony and is hub of Urdu, Hindi and many Hindustani Languages. After the First War of Independence in 1857, the British took over the city of Lucknow and Hazratganj was modeled after Queen Street in London. In 2010, after nearly 200 years, Hazratganj received a makeover. Buildings were painted in a uniform color, and stone pavements and Victorian style balustrades were constructed to enhance the architecture.
